Output 30d506141cb3372f8d5581f53032fffe9669e18fff5803450d6a1a9f70580d9a:3

value
17104496
script pubkey
OP_0 OP_PUSHBYTES_20 9f248d00cafd18d86bd2562ffa8e87cb5d2ea9af
address
ltc1qnujg6qx2l5vds67j2chl4r58edwja2d0d8dy28
transaction
30d506141cb3372f8d5581f53032fffe9669e18fff5803450d6a1a9f70580d9a
spent
true